In 1994 he created, together with partner Diego Guebel, Caito Lorenzo and Sebastian Melendez the Cuatro Cabezas (or 4K) TV production company, which is now one of the three most important media holdings in Argentina.

The CQC format has been sold to several countries (Chile, Brazil, Mexico, France, Italy, Spain, and Israel).

The Israel TV version (anchored by Avri Gilad) did not catch with Israeli audiences and was discontinued after half a season.
